Public Museum to host a Titanic tribute night
GRAND RAPIDS (WZZM)- This week, the Grand Rapids Public Museum will be hosting a special event paying tribute to the Titanic.
Kate Moore, Director of Marketing and Public Relations and Wendy Batchelder, Costume Interpretation stopped by our studios with a preview.
The event on February 21st, a cocktail hour starts the festivities, followed by a tapas-style strolling dinner. Items from first, second and third class menus from Titanic will be served including: Atlantic salmon with mousseline sauce, roasted squab with plum sauce and watercress, mini rabbit pie with wild mushrooms and cider, and Waldorf pudding with apples and walnuts - to name a few.
